Environment

Coffee beans are grown in an environment which is impacted by a variety of environmental issues. Some of them include deforestation, soil erosion, and water pollution. Certain large coffee companies have taken steps to lessen their environmental impact, but there is still much work to be completed. This includes encouraging sustainable farming practices as well as offering financial support to initiatives to preserve the environment.

A number of papers have studied the effects of climate change on the production of coffee. They have discovered that climate can have a significant impact on the quality and yield of coffee beans. However, the effect of the changing climate on the production of coffee is contingent on the nature of the farm and methods of farming employed. For instance the beans grown by farmers who grow their plants in shade have greater acidity, aroma and typicity than those grown in sunlight. In addition, the beans produced by farmers who employ agroforestry techniques tend to have more flavor, aroma, and acidity than those cultivated in monocultures.

The overuse of chemicals is another significant problem in the production of coffee. These chemicals are not only harmful to humans and the environment, but they also pollute water. This is particularly relevant to non-organic coffee that makes use of synthetic fertilizers and pesticides. The chemicals that are used up can leak into the water and alter ecosystems. This could be harmful to humans as well as wildlife.

The high price of making coffee may make it difficult for many families. Additionally, the absence of consistent rainfall could affect the harvest. This is because the conditions for growing arabica coffee beans 1kg are very specific and a lack rain could result in less of a crop.

Climate change will have a major impact on the ability of areas to cultivate coffee. According to research, a significant decrease in suitable land will be observed and an increase in unsuitable area in most of the major coffee-producing countries. This will lead to conflicts between the production of coffee and conservation of nature. This will also decrease the amount of ecosystem services offered by coffee-growing regions including regulating or supporting services.

Taste

The flavor of coffee is an individual preference. The best method to find the most flavorful coffee is to experiment with different grind sizes, brewing methods and even mixing beans. If you purchase by the kilo, you have more flexibility to experiment, which can result in a more enjoyable experience for your taste buds. It's also more cost-effective in the long run as buying by the kilo helps reduce the amount of packaging waste. Coffee grounds, which are a result of your daily brew, can be composted, so purchasing in bulk is green.

If you're just beginning to learn about espresso, it's likely you'll have to go through several 250g bags to get your extraction down. This isn't an uncommon occurrence and is an important element of learning curve. A purchase by the kilo will give you enough beans to get you through this stage, and perhaps even aid you in transferring to other brewing methods after you've learned the basics.

A kilo of kilo purchase is cheaper than purchasing smaller bags as you'll save money on the costs of packaging and delivery. When you buy by the kilo, you can also reduce your carbon footprint. This is because you use fewer bags, and you use fewer sealing and degassing strips than if you purchased one or two 250g-bags at each time. The fewer bags used will also result in less waste in landfills.
